Jim Lux wrote:
> At 10:55 AM 11/16/2006, k6xyz wrote:
>>Any problem with using aluminum wire for a radial system??
>
>
> Choose your alloy properly so it doesn't corrode, and it should work
> fine.  Maybe cathodic protection might be wise?

I bought alloy 1100 soft annealed.  Basically, pure aluminum.
They sell it as "tie wire", to tie by hand to package stuff.
Pure aluminum is supposed to be the most corrosion proof,
AFAIK.
